Historical & Cultural Background

Suleima is derived from Arabic roots and is often associated with peace and tranquility. In Hebrew contexts, it can signify completeness or wholeness. The name has been used in various cultures, particularly in Middle Eastern and Jewish communities. It reflects a blend of cultural significance and linguistic heritage.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Suleima was first seen in the United States in 1990. Suleima has ranked as high as #1194 nationally, which occurred in 1990, and has been most popular in California, and Texas. In the past 5 years the name Suleima has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
